Defensivo



Example: Ele adotou um tom defensivo durante a discussão acalorada.

Definition


"Defensive" is an adjective describing a behavior or attitude characterized by protection against criticism, attack, or perceived threat. For example, when someone adopts a "defensive" tone during a heated discussion, they are trying to guard themselves from criticism or conflict.

Etymology


The word "defensive" comes from the Latin verb 'defendere,' meaning 'to ward off or protect.' It entered English through Old French 'defensif.' Did you know? The root 'defendere' also gives us the word 'defend,' highlighting the protective nature of being 'defensive.'
